NEW Member - Islander 32-2

Greetings and Happy New Year!

I am a new member to this group.
I have owned several sailboats, Including a Hunter 31' and an O'Day 28'

I now own a REAL BARN FIND!
an Islander 32-2, 1977. This boat sat for SIXTEEN years untouched, except for engine maintenance and bottom cleaning!
she has a 1993 Yanmar 3gm30f, with less than 150 hours!
NEW main sail used once. ALL sails and canvas stored in a warehouse!
we are completely re-doing her, and have motored about a few times in the intercostal. We are having the rig inspected and tuned this week.

I know there are a few Islander 32's around and would live to be able to ask model specific questions, and learn from suggestions --
